This Introduction to Documentary course offered by Australian City Design College is suitable for those have an idea for a documentary but aren’t sure where to start.
This short course is the perfect introduction for people who have little or no knowledge of making documentaries but have a strong interest in developing storytelling skills and connecting with audiences through true stories.
Programme Structure
The program focuses on:
- Ethical Considerations
- Indigenous Protocols
- Choosing your subject
- Analysing your documentary
- Pre-production
- Safety on set
- Data management
- Interview skills and preparing for interviews for filming
- Camera styles and skills
- Sound editing considerations
- Presenting and evaluating your own film
